keecas

A module for performing symbolic and units-aware calculations in a jupyter notebook.

Introduction

keecas is a Python module designed to simplify symbolic and units-aware calculations. It leverages well-known Python modules such as sympy, pint, and pipe to provide a convenient and easy-to-use interface.

It's meant to be used in a interactive environment such as jupyter notebook. It produces latex amsmath code that can be rendered by the notebook, displaying nicely formatted math expression.

It's been developed to be used for Quarto rendered pdf documents, and it provides some specific features such as cross-reference support for equation.

Features

  • Symbolic expression and computation using sympy
  • Units-aware calculations using pint
  • pipe style functions with pipe

Installation

To install keecas, run the following command:

pip install keecas

or

uv add keecas

Dependencies

keecas depends on the following packages:

  • flatten-dict
  • ipython
  • pint
  • pipe
  • regex
  • ruamel-yaml
  • sympy
